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Longfield to Knockholt start from £10.20 one way, or £10.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Longfield to Knockholt are available for £10.50 one way, or £10.80 return

Longfield Station Amenities and Services

At Longfield station, ticket purchasing and collection are made easy with an available ticket office and machines. The ticket office hours are generous, from early morning to late evening on weekdays, ensuring you can buy or collect tickets even if you’re catching a train during peak commuting hours. On weekends, the service continues, though with slightly shorter hours. You can also collect tickets bought online at the machines.

Passenger support is robust, with staff available throughout most of the day to assist with questions or special travel needs. There’s a help point at the station where staff can offer guidance and assistance. The station proudly holds Secure Station accreditation, a testament to its commitment to safety and service quality. If you need extra assistance, it's available during station staffing times.

For those who drive to the station, a car park operated by APCOA Parking offers 88 spaces, with dedicated accessible spaces. The parking is available around the clock, and there are parking options to suit various needs, from daily to annual passes, ensuring flexibility and convenience. Cycling enthusiasts can also enjoy the benefits of leaving their bikes in secure, albeit unsheltered, bicycle stands. With CCTV monitoring, although not in the cycle area, your vehicle's safety is prioritized.

Accessibility and Assistance

Longfield station accommodates travelers with mobility requirements, with step-free access available on both directions of the platforms. If you need assistance boarding or alighting from trains, staff can provide ramps and help, making train travel more accessible. However, while there are accessible ticket machines, it’s wor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or facilities for storing luggage.

Station Features and Facilities

Knockholt Train Station is equipped with a range of facilities to enhance your travel experience. Ticket purchasing is made easy with both a ticket office and machines available. The ticket office operates from 06:15 to 09:40, Monday to Friday, and tickets purchased online can be conveniently collected at the station. For those relying on accessibility options, step-free access is available to Platform 1 for journeys to London, while Platform 2 is only accessible via steps. The station ensures passenger safety with CCTV monitoring and offers seating areas for your comfort.

Onward Travel Connections

Getting to your next destination from Knockholt is straightforward thanks to its efficient transport links. For those needing to continue their journey by road, rail replacement services can convey you towards Orpington at Bus Stop B or towards Sevenoaks at Bus Stop A, both located on London Road. While there aren't direct cycle hire facilities available, cyclists can store their bicycles at the designated racks on Platform 1 near the entrance.
